In the fall of 2022, Purdue University’s West Lafayette campus welcomed more than 9,300 new freshmen, which was a big group of students. Before that, in the previous time when students applied, the university got a really high number of applications—68,309 to be exact.

Even though the rate of students getting accepted has been around 50%, it’s important to realize that Purdue University is quite picky. Especially if you’re aiming for their top-ranked engineering and computer science programs, it’s harder to get in. Indiana residents usually have a better chance compared to students from other states or countries.

Because there are a lot of smart students wanting to join the Boilermaker community, it’s really important for potential students to understand that it’s a competitive process.

When Purdue University–West Lafayette looks at who to let in, they are careful. About half of the students they accept have SAT scores between 1190 and 1430, or ACT scores of 26 to 33. But a quarter of the students they accept have scores above these numbers, and another quarter have scores below. The university accepts applications all the time, and it costs $60 to apply.

When they decide who gets in, they really care about how well a student did in school (GPA). They also think about things like class rank if they know it, and they pay attention to letters of recommendation that people write for the student. Purdue University Acceptance Rate – 2023

For those aspiring to be part of the Class of 2026 at Purdue, the acceptance rate stood at 53%. Applicants from within the state usually have a five-point edge in the admissions process.

Nevertheless, it’s worth highlighting that the requirements for getting into different colleges within Purdue University are quite diverse. While the exact acceptance rates for specific colleges are not disclosed, we do have information about their more competitive programs:

Purdue College of Engineering

  • The average accepted engineering applicant has an unweighted 3.82 GPA.
  • The average SAT score for an accepted engineering student is above 1430; on the ACT, it is a 32.
  • A couple of years ago, the reported acceptance rate for engineering applicants was around 40%; this is likely lower in 2023.

Computer Science

  • While the school doesn’t offer any official figures, the Purdue CS acceptance rate is believed to be as low as a touch under 10% or as high as 15%, depending on the year.
  • The number of accepted internal CS transfer applicants has dwindled each year as Computer Science has become Purdue’s most popular major.

Purdue Admissions – SAT, ACT, GPA, and Class Rank

Among those enrolled in the Class of 2026, the mid-50% GPA was 3.5-3.9, the SAT range was 1190-1410 and the ACT range 26-33. Further, 53% were in the top decile of their high school class, 82% were in the top quartile, and 97% were in the top half.

Admissions Trends & Notes – Class of 2026

  • Purdue announced that they will require SAT/ACT scores for the 2024 admissions cycle.
  • The overall number of applications increased from 59,173 for the Class of 2025 to over 68,000 for the Class of 2026.
  • There are 135 countries represented on campus as the number of international students remained on an upward trend.
  • 13% of freshmen are underrepresented minorities.
  • 26% of 2022-23 freshmen enrolled in the College of Engineering, the most of any school.

Who Gets Into Purdue University—West Lafayette?

Let’s look at the demographics of Purdue undergraduates:

Purdue undergrads hailed in fairly equal numbers from the state of Indiana and other states in the U.S.:

  • From Indiana: 47%
  • Out-of-State: 42%
  • International: 11%

Looking at ethnic identity among the current Boilermaker undergraduate student body, the breakdown is as follows:

  • Asian American: 12%
  • Hispanic: 6%
  • African American: 2%
  • International: 11%
  • White: 63%
  • Two or more races: 4%

International undergraduate students hail from 113 countries with the greatest representation from the following nations:

  • China
  • India
  • South Korea
  • Taiwan
  • Vietnam

The breakdown by gender of the Class of 2025 shows a heavier concentration of male students:

  • Male: 57%
  • Female: 43%

With so many more male students at Purdue, female applicants do enjoy an advantage in the admissions process. For the Class of 2026 applicants, women were admitted at a 64% clip compared to a 45% figure for men.

Purdue’s Yield Rate

For the Class of 2026, Purdue University observed a yield rate of 26%, a metric derived from the division of the accepted students who choose to enroll by the total count of admitted individuals. Interestingly, this figure falls below the yield rates seen in certain other well-regarded public institutions, such as UT-Austin, Georgia Tech, and Ohio State.

How Purdue Rates Applicants

  • Purdue University emphasizes three key factors as highly significant in their admissions assessment: the applicant’s GPA, standardized test scores, and the level of challenge in their high school coursework. Additionally, five factors hold notable importance in the Purdue evaluation: letters of recommendation, essays, involvement in extracurricular activities, being a first-generation student, and demonstrating commendable character and personal qualities.

In the admissions office’s own words:

  • “Admission to Purdue is based on a holistic evaluation of each student’s application in the context of the overall applicant pool for a particular Purdue college or specific major. For example, admission to nursing is highly competitive because it is a small program with a large applicant pool.”
  • “You can use our Freshman Class Profile Page to see “middle 50%” ranges for GPAs and SAT or ACT tests. However, these ranges represent the entire freshman class – the middle 50% for individual majors may be higher or lower based on space availability or the rigor of the program’s curriculum.”

Tips for Applying to Purdue University—West Lafayette

If you plan on joining the 68,000+ Boilermaker hopefuls for the next admissions cycle, you should know the following:

  • Purdue does not offer interviews. Therefore, the best way to personalize the admissions process is through your essays and recommendations.
  • Purdue considers “demonstrated interest” in the admissions process. This means you may gain an advantage by visiting campus, connecting through social media, emailing an admissions officer, etc.
  • You can apply by November 1 to meet the Early Action Deadline. The Regular Decision deadline is January 15. However, the earlier you submit your application, the better.
  • Make sure to dedicate sufficient time and effort to the (up to) three short answer prompts that you may need to address. They are as follows:
  1. How will opportunities at Purdue support your interests, both in and out of the classroom? (100 words)
  2. Briefly discuss your reasons for pursuing the major you have selected. (100 words)
  3. Please briefly elaborate on one of your extracurricular activities or work experiences. (250 words)

Summary of Purdue University Acceptance Rate

Purdue University students typically showcase scholastic achievements with A- to B+ grade averages, earned through dedicated efforts within a demanding high school curriculum.

Aside from that, they exhibit standardized test scores that surpass the 90th percentile among all test-takers, indicating above-average performance.

However, for those aspiring to join the realms of engineering or computer science, a higher level of accomplishment is encouraged, with virtually all A grades and standardized test scores exceeding the 95th percentile being recommended.
